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/wordpress/11.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ipad UIModalPresentationFormsheet操作不刷新主视图_Ipad_Uiview_Refresh_Uimodalpresentationformsh - Fatal编程技术网

Ipad UIModalPresentationFormsheet操作不刷新主视图

Ipad UIModalPresentationFormsheet操作不刷新主视图,ipad,uiview,refresh,uimodalpresentationformsh,Ipad,Uiview,Refresh,Uimodalpresentationformsh,我有一个包含员工数据列表的表。用户可以选择员工并批准/拒绝员工的申请。如果被拒绝,用户应选择拒绝原因并输入注释。我正在使用UIModalPresentationFormsheet显示一个带有UIExtField、UIPicker和两个按钮(拒绝和取消)的视图 当用户点击reject按钮时,我会调用web服务来更改服务器中的状态,并更改保存员工数据的本地对象中的值。点击拒绝操作时,我可以执行这两个操作,但后台的主屏幕不会刷新。但是,当我尝试正常推送拒绝屏幕(而不是UIModalPresentati

我有一个包含员工数据列表的表。用户可以选择员工并批准/拒绝员工的申请。如果被拒绝,用户应选择拒绝原因并输入注释。我正在使用UIModalPresentationFormsheet显示一个带有UIExtField、UIPicker和两个按钮(拒绝和取消)的视图

当用户点击reject按钮时,我会调用web服务来更改服务器中的状态,并更改保存员工数据的本地对象中的值。点击拒绝操作时,我可以执行这两个操作,但后台的主屏幕不会刷新。但是,当我尝试正常推送拒绝屏幕(而不是UIModalPresentationFormsheet)时,一切都正常

我尝试调用该函数来强制刷新视图,但它仍然不起作用。谁能帮我解决这个问题


谢谢您……

使用
NSNotificationCenter

[[NSNotificationCenter defaultCenter] addObserver:self selector:@selector(updateSomething:) name:@"updateSomething" object:nil];

[[NSNotificationCenter defaultCenter] postNotificationName:@"updateSomething" object:nil];

谢谢WrightCS。。。我没有机会实现它,但已经通过了NSNotificationCenter,我认为它应该解决我的问题。很抱歉迟到了(回复已经几天没有上网了)。。。